Description

DNAAF3 (dynein axonemal assembly factor 3) encodes a protein involved in the cytoplasmic preassembly of axonemal dynein complexes, which are essential for ciliary and flagellar motility. Mutations in DNAAF3 cause primary ciliary dyskinesia type 16 (CILD16), characterized by respiratory tract infections, infertility, and situs inversus.

Mutation functional classification

Loss of Function (LOF)

Nonsense and frameshift mutations in DNAAF3 result in truncated or absent protein, disrupting dynein arm preassembly and causing primary ciliary dyskinesia.

Protein Summary

DNAAF3 is a 574-amino-acid protein localized to the cytoplasm, where it participates in the preassembly of dynein arm complexes before their transport to cilia. It contains a coiled-coil domain and is conserved across ciliated species. Loss of DNAAF3 function leads to absence of both outer and inner dynein arms in cilia, resulting in immotile cilia and primary ciliary dyskinesia.
